Flash Flood

Franklin, KY · Jun 23, 2017

Tropical Storm Cindy made landfall along the Gulf Coast and quickly lifted northeast toward the lower Ohio Valley June 22-23. The remnants interacted with a cold front from the Upper Midwest to produced widespread heavy rainfall.

Flash Flood

Fleming, KY · Jun 23, 2017

The combination of the remnants of Tropical Cyclone Cindy and a late June cold front brought widespread showers and thunderstorms to much of eastern Kentucky this evening.

Flood

Harlan, KY · May 28, 2017

Numerous strong to severe thunderstorms caused wind damage, flash flooding, and dropped large hail across eastern Kentucky during the afternoon and evening hours of Saturday, May 27, 2017. The largest hail reported occurred in Powell County and was the size of golf balls.
